Abstract

Charging along: DNA-mediated charge transport across adenine tracts is monitored by using a probe interior to the bridge (N6-cyclopropyladenine (CPA), shown in red). This trap was incorporated serially across the bridge and could be oxidized by a distal rhodium photooxidant without significant attenuation in yield over a distance of 5 nm. These results are consistent with complete delocalization of charge across the DNA bridge.
